Dear Families — Here’s What You Should Know

We understand that your daughter’s safety, wellbeing and comfort are everything. Her Safe Space was created with emotional safety, trust, and transparency in mind.

✅ All groups are age-matched (12–13, 14–16)
✅ Group size capped at 3–5 girls
✅ Weekly Zooms are led and monitored by Veronica
✅ One-on-one intro calls are done with both parent + teen before joining
✅ No pressure to speak or turn camera on
✅ Monthly email updates for parents
✅ Permission forms required for in-person events

Why I Created Her Safe Space?

I’m Veronica — a teacher, behaviour therapist, and a little introvert who remembers how hard it was to feel like I belonged. I changed friends often, pretended to care about things I didn’t, and felt like I had to perform just to fit in.

Her Safe Space is what I wish I had growing up — a place where girls could be soft, sensitive, awkward, unsure… and still be enough.

I’m not here to fix anyone. I’m here to be a friend, hold space, and help girls realise they don’t have to change to belong.

Her Safe Space is a wellbeing circle — not therapy, not school. Just a soft, guided space where your daughter can be herself.
